Ahead of Friday's draw, Zinedine Zidane - manager of current and 11-time European champions Real Madrid - has paid the Foxes quite the compliment.
Although many will see Leicester as the weaker of the eight teams that remain in the competition, Zidane made it perfectly clear that he doesn't fancy playing them.
“I don’t think there will be a single coach who are hoping they face Leicester.
“They keep achieving what they are told they can’t achieve.
“Many thought they couldn't turnaround the defeat against Sevilla and they did."
